(1) The regulator may impose any conditions it considers appropriate on the registration of a plant design.
(2) Without limiting subregulation (1), the regulator may impose conditions in relation to one or more of the following matters:
(a) the use and maintenance of plant manufactured to the design;
(b) the recording or keeping of information;
(c) the provision of information to the regulator.
Note 1: A person must comply with the conditions of registration (see section 45 of the Act).
Note 2: A decision to impose a condition on a registration is a
reviewable decision (see regulation 676).
